The cheapest way to get from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ore is to bus and train which costs €35 - €65 and takes 8h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ore is to drive which takes 4h 37m and costs €55 - €85.
No, there is no direct bus from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ore. However, there are services departing from Pistoia and arriving at Locarno, Piazza Stazione via Prato Piazzale Del Museo,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station and Bellinzona, Piazza Orico.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 28m.
No, there is no direct train from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ore. However, there are services departing from Pistoia and arriving at Locarno via Firenze S.M.N. and Milano Centrale.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 29m.
The distance between Pistoia and Lake Maggiore is 449 km. The road distance is 366.6 km.
The best way to get from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ore without a car is to train which takes 5h 29m and costs €70 - €230.
It takes approximately 5h 29m to get from Pistoia to Lake Maggiore, including transfers.
